-
백준 2884 -알람시계백준 algorithm 2019. 12. 27. 11:00반응형
빼려는 시간이 정해져있기 때문에 간단하다.
0시 0분일때의 경우를 계산해야한다.
#include <iostream> using namespace std; void Calc(int* H, int* M) { if (*M >= 45) { *M = *M - 45; return; } else { int tmp = 45 - *M; *M = 60 - tmp; if (*H != 0) { *H -= 1; } else { *H = 23; } return; } } int H, M; int main() { cin >> H >> M; Calc(&H, &M); cout << H << " " << M << '\n'; return 0; }
반응형'백준 algorithm' 카테고리의 다른 글
백준 - 11022 A+B -8 (0) 2019.12.27 백준 2742 - 기찍 N (0) 2019.12.27 백준 10817 - 세 수 (0) 2019.12.26 백준 2588 곱셈 (0) 2019.12.20 백준 11866 조세퍼스 문제 0 (0) 2019.12.20